How do you cut already installed ceramic tile?
Turn the angle grinder so the blade will meet the tile perpendicularly. Turn on the grinder and push the blade straight down into the tile and its backing. Once you have cut through, you can pull the blade back for a short cut, or push the blade away from you to continue cutting through the tile for longer cuts.

Can you cut ceramic tile with a circular saw?
Can I cut tile with a circular saw? Yes! The perfect tile cutting blade for a circular saw when performing on porcelain, is the diamond blade, because is one of the few materials that are harder than porcelain. In a few words, the diamond blade not only score the tile but grinds it all the way through.

Can you cut metal with a Dremel?
That said, you can use a Dremel to cut steel if you use the tool within its capabilities, that is, very light and shallow cuts. Since you don’t usually flood the workpiece or the tool with coolant when using a Dremel, a diamond cutter or tunsten carbide cutter would work.

Can I cut acrylic with a Dremel?
If you REALLY want to cut acrylic with your dremel, you’ll want to put it on the lowest rpm setting and push very hard to remove the most amount of material possible. You’ll also want to get a dremel cutting bit (not a cut off wheel, but a wheel with actual teeth).
